Transaction ed59aae8719621f24ea74b674a8db7237acf635574d662883c1aa83744b90816
1 Input
1 Output
-
ed59aae8719621f24ea74b674a8db7237acf635574d662883c1aa83744b90816:0
- value
- 1382674
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1cf7ba6fd8b037d4f282127776ad1433c47b01d
- address
- bc1qk88hhfha3vph6negyynhw6k3gv7y0vqavnu3xy